Sign up for our Free Regulatory Newsletter for Payment Service Providers!

Consumer Reviews as Leading Indicator for Merchant Risk

This whitepaper explores the challenges of risk management for acquiring banks and payment facilitators in the growing digital payments landscape. Focusing on merchant credit risk and non-delivery exposure, the whitepaper introduces consumer review scores as potential leading indicators for chargeback risks. It emphasizes the significance of changes in these scores in signaling underlying financial or operational issues, providing timely triggers for risk managers. 

Fill out the form and download your copy!

Want to see Owlin in action?

Learn more about our solutions and see how we can help your business.
We look forward to meeting you.

Request a demo

Back to top